Nothing wrong with asking for help.
1: Root SSH. Watch top and see what is the main culprit - look out for apache, mysql, exim or suspicious looking processes taking a lot of resources.
2: I can see you use CPanel, go into the root WHM and look at the Apache Status, Email Queue, information provided here usually gives you the answer. For mass email queues check the mail headers, 90 percent of the time you will be able to tell which account is causing this.
3: There are a number of security hardening measures which you can do for a free hosting environment. That'd be a long list, let me know if you have no clue here as well.
4: Root SSH, run the updatedb command and "locate" a few common keywords which you want to have nothing to do with![]()
